New Orleans Spring Fiesta Association
826 St. Ann Street
New Orleans, Louisiana  70116
USA

Reviews of New Orleans Spring Fiesta Association
Be the first one to rate and write a review for this New Orleans Spring Fiesta Association establishment!
 
 
Sponsored
links



Tickets ads